Reports show a significant drop in the number of registered voters who say they are Christian


bigstock Vote Election Badge Button For 264971236 us election 2020(Worthy News) –
A new report has shown that the number of registered voters who say they are Christian has fallen by around 15% since 2008, the Christian Post reported Thursday. The Pew Research Center report also showed that the number of voters who say they are not religiously affiliated more than doubled in that time.

The Pew report was based on data obtained from a sample of more than 360,000 registered voters surveyed over 25 years.

The study showed that in 2008, 79% of registered voters identified as Christian. That figure was down to 64% in 2019, the Christian Post reported. Moreover, the number of voters who say they have no religious affiliation went up from 15% in 2008 to 79% in 2019.

In regard to faith affiliation and political persuasion, the report showed that the number of Christian Democrats dropped from 73% in 2008 to 52% in 2019. For Republicans, the numbers were 87% Christian in 2008 and 79% Christian in 2019.

Commenting on the findings to the Christian Post, Galen Carey, the National Association of Evangelicals vice president of government relations, said: “The number of Americans of faith is declining. The concern to us is not how many Christians are registered voters but how many voters are Christians.”
